South Australia’s premium produce and world-class beverages will be in the spotlight over the next 10 days, as Tasting Australia presented by Journey Beyond gets underway across the state. 

More than 150 events across all 12 of the state’s tourism regions will connect foodies and festivalgoers to the unique flavours of South Australia.

Tasting Australia follows Adelaide Festival and Adelaide Fringe, plus major sporting events including the Santos Tour Down Under, Adelaide International, LIV Golf and the AFL Gather Round. Together these events contribute to record high results for the State’s tourism industry.

This year’s program highlights include a festival-first takeover of The Ghan with the iconic Darwin to Adelaide train journey through the outback, a seafood-inspired day trip to the Eyre Peninsula, and a day to celebrate Yorke Peninsula’s talented producers. 

After attracting 65,000 attendees last year, the free entry festival hub ‘Town Square’ returns to Victoria Square/Tarntanyangga, giving visitors a taste of the state’s regional hospitality and produce offerings – enticing them to visit regional South Australia beyond the festival.


New flavours are being served with nine first-time vendors to Town Square such as Patch Kitchen, Dirty Doris and Hokey Pokey from the Adelaide Hills. Other Town Square attractions include the Seppeltsfield (Barossa) bar and Never Never (Fleurieu Peninsula) Martini Bar, as well as a main stage line-up of local musicians and DJs. 

Free programming this year includes the new Homemade series, where chefs and South Australian producers share tips for home cooking success, plus the new Latte Art Smackdown and the return of Tasting Australia’s hotly contested Waiters’ Race.

This year’s festival coincides with the Australian Tourism Exchange (ATE) – which is Tourism Australia’s annual flagship tourism tradeshow. Town Square will welcome around 2,500 delegates from ATE, including over 700 travel buyers from 30 countries, for a special event on Monday 11 May which aims to highlight South Australia’s renowned produce and beverages to those who package, sell and promote the state in their markets around the world. 

The 19th edition of Tasting Australia presented by Journey Beyond is taking place in Adelaide and regional South Australia until 17 May. Visit tastingaustralia.com.au for more information.
